View of rooftops covered in snow, in the Old Town, from the Old Town Bridge Tower (dating from 1830) on the eastern end of Charles Bridge. To the left in the foreground is the dome (green) of the Church of St Francis (Kostel Sv Frantiska). This was once part of the monastery of the crusading Knights of the Cross with the Red Star. To the right of the hexagonal dome and pair of spires is the facade of the Holy saviour (Kostel Sv Salvatora), part of the huge Clementinum complex. This church facade dominates the eastern end of the Knights of the Cross Square (Krizovnicke Namesti). It was built in 1601 and has seven large statues of saints by Jan Bendl (1659) and is dramatically lit up at night. To the centre (cream coloured tower) is an observatory tower and behind this in the distance (with a clockface) is the Old Town Hall Tower (Staromestska radnice), built in 1364. The tower is 228 feet (69.5 metres) high and offers spectacular views.
